




Story Behind the Art: Oushak rugs originate from the west-central Anatolian town of Oushak in Turkey, a historic weaving center long admired for producing rugs with distinctive texture, generous scale, and graceful design. These rugs belong to a specific lineage of patterns developed in the U?ak region and are instantly recognizable for their oversized motifs and spacious compositions. Design elements commonly include bold geometric forms, prominent central medallions, repeating allover medallions, or loosely scattered vine scrolls and palmettes that create a sense of openness and movement. Woven from lustrous wool, Oushak rugs traditionally employ muted, earthy color palettes that enhance their versatility and timeless character. Their balanced blend of softness, scale, and elegance has made Oushak rugs a favored choice across a wide range of interior styles.
